noun
- plural of nose; the organs of smell and breathing on the face
verb
- third person singular present of nose; moves forward carefully or cautiously
- third person singular present of nose; searches or pries into something
Usage: informal
Examples
- The children wrinkled their noses at the smell.
- Both dogs had wet noses from playing outside.
- The car noses into the parking space slowly.
- She always noses around in other people’s business.
- The boat noses through the fog carefully.
- He noses into every conversation at work.
